Ok...a tad skeptical about the times. Sure, some GREAT performances, but seems like a few TOO many folks set PBs--many who have been racing for many many years (Jenny Crain for example). Nine out of ten women? Six out of ten men? From what I have heard, it was a good day for running, but by no means "perfect" conditions...anyone have any thoughts? Just curious.
MEN -
1. Ryan Hall, 24, 59:43 AR
2. Fasil Bizuneh, 26, 1:02:20 PB
3. Meb Keflezighi, 31, 1:02:22
4. Andrew Carlson, 24, 1:02:44 PB
5. Jason Lehmkuhle, 29, 1:02:51 PB
6. Brian Sell, 28, 1:03:10
7. Joe Driscoll, 27, 1:03:27 PB
8. Dan Browne, 31, 1:03:55
9. Travis Laird, 25, 1:03:57 PB
10. Justin Young, 27, 1:03:58
WOMEN -
1. Elva Dryer, 35, 1:11:42 PB
2. Kate O'Neill, 26, 1:11:47 PB
3. Michelle Lilienthal, 24, 1:12:46 PB
4. Alvina Begay, 26, 1:12:57 PB
5. Tars Storage, 25, 1:13:14 PB
6. Jenny Crain, 38, 1:13:37 PB
7. Zoila Gomez, 27, 1:13:49 PB
8. Kristin Price, 25, 1:13:52 PB
9. Ann Alyanak, 28, 1:14:24 PB
10. Samia Akbar, 25, 1:14:48
